Best Mechanicsburg 51³Ô¹ÏÍøºÚÁÏ (2025-26)

For the 2025-26 school year, there are 18 public schools serving 13,843 students in Mechanicsburg, PA (there are , serving 968 private students). 93% of all K-12 students in Mechanicsburg, PA are educated in public schools (compared to the PA state average of 86%).
The top ranked public schools in Mechanicsburg, PA are Green Ridge Elementary School, Hampden Elementary School and Cumberland Valley High School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Mechanicsburg, PA public schools have an average math proficiency score of 53% (versus the Pennsylvania public school average of 38%), and reading proficiency score of 73% (versus the 55% statewide average). Schools in Mechanicsburg have an average ranking of 9/10, which is in the top 20% of Pennsylvania public schools.
Minority enrollment is 37% of the student body (majority Asian), which is less than the Pennsylvania public school average of 39% (majority Hispanic and Black).
